A chance meeting on a train to Tokyo sends two girls named Nana on a collision course with destiny! Nana "Hachi" Komatsu hopes that moving to Tokyo will help her make a clean start and leave her capricious love life behind her. Nana Osaki, who arrives in the city at the same time, has plans to score big in the world of rock'n'roll. Although these two young women come from different backgrounds, they quickly become best friends in a whirlwind world of sex, music, fashion, gossip and all-night parties! Filled with magic and mayhem, adventure and action, swords and spells,
book one in the Song of the Lioness quartet is the ultimate
introduction to Alanna and Tamora Pierce’s legendary Tortall universe.
In Song of the Lioness, Book 1: Alanna, the first of four volumes
adapting #1 New York Times bestseller Tamora Pierce’s Song of the
Lioness quartet, we meet Alanna of Trebond, a young noblewoman from the
kingdom of Tortall.
Alanna isn’t like other girls from noble families—what she really wants
is to become a knight and earn her shield, something women definitely
aren’t allowed to do.
But Alanna will not be deterred, and she arrives in the capital
disguised as a boy to begin training as a page, the first step toward
becoming a knight. Despite the tough conditions and grueling work,
Alanna’s skills and stubbornness win her friends amongst the nobility
and the denizens of the lower city. But not everyone wishes her well .
. .

Fresh from his triumphs in the Trojan War, Odysseus, King of
Ithaca, wants to return to his family. Instead, he offends the sea
god Poseidon, who dooms him to long years of shipwreck &
wandering. In his efforts to get home, he battles man-eating
monsters, violent storms, & the supernatural seductions of
sirens & sorceresses.

First published in 1962, this book provides a systematic account of
the development of Plato's theory of knowledge. Beginning with a
consideration of the Socratic and other influences which determined
the form in which the problem of knowledge first presented itself
to Plato, the author then works through the dialogues from the Meno
to the Laws and examines in detail Plato's progressive attempts to
solve the problem.
